If Caterpillar wished to reach the market in Malaysia but was leery of a direct investment in the country, it might provide a Ma

laysian operation with the knowledge to produce and market its products in exchange for a commission. This type of arrangement is called ___________.
A) licensing.B) exporting.C) a strategic alliance.D) a joint venture.E) contract manufacturing.

Answer:

licensing agreement

Explanation:

Licensing agreement -

It is the legal contract between a licensor and a licensee , where the licensor gives the permission to the licensee for the production of certain product or service , and the licensee pays a certain amount , is known as a licensing agreement .

Hence , from the question , the type of agreement showcased in the question is about licensing agreement .

The addition of interest added to the principal in a retirement account over time is called
Monica [59]
Compound interest is the term in which it is added to the principal amount in a retirement account as time passes by. It is often the called the "interest on interest." It is accumulated during the past deposits that had taken place over a period of time.
